Election 2023: Polls remain deadlocked

An improved showing for Labour in the latest Talbot Mills political poll at the start of June has helped the party to close the gap slightly on National in BusinessDesk's polltracker average, but the right still holds a slight advantage.The two main parties remain essentially deadlocked, with Labour on 34% and National 35%, according to the time-weighted average of public opinion polls.Support for the Greens and Act remains steady at 8% and 12% respectively.NZ First support seems to have faded slightly in recent weeks, while Te Pāti Māori i...
